#2e4241 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e4241 is composed of 18% red, 25.9%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.5%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 177 degrees, a saturation of 17.9% and a lightness of 22%. #2e4241 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c8482 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2e4241 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
#2e4241 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e4241 has RGB values of R:46, G:66,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 3031617.
